How to Play Plinko at UK Online Casinos

Playing Plinko is simple: you set a bet, pick a risk level, and drop a virtual disc down a pyramid of pegs. The disc bounces left and right until it lands in a slot at the bottom. Each slot has a multiplier that decides your payout. That’s the whole game. But the simplicity hides a few decisions that matter more than they look.

Setting Your Risk Level

The risk setting determines the distribution of multipliers. Low risk gives a tight range of small wins and frequent returns; high risk throws in a few huge multipliers but makes the middle slots worth almost nothing. Most Plinko games let you choose between 8, 12 and 16 rows, with more rows meaning more extreme variance. The house edge doesn’t magically disappear at any setting, but the experience changes from “slow grind” to “lottery ticket”.

Choosing a Bet Size

Because Plinko is a negative-expectation game, the bet size is really a question of bankroll endurance. A £0.10 bet on high risk will last a while but may never hit the 1000x multiplier; a £10 bet on low risk will burn through your deposit faster than you’d think. Most experienced players set a session budget first, then divide it into 100–200 drops. That’s not a winning strategy, but it turns the game from a two-minute disaster into a twenty-minute pastime.

The Math Behind the Bounce

Unlike blackjack or poker, Plinko has no choices after the drop. The outcome is a pure random walk, and the only strategic input is the risk level you pick before you click. That means every “Plinko strategy” you see online is either a bet-sizing routine or a martingale variant, and martingale on a high-variance game is a fast way to learn why casinos have maximum bet limits. The expected value is always negative, but the variance is what makes it fun—or brutal.

Plinko Casino Game Variants: Slots, Live and Crypto Versions

Plinko isn’t one game; it’s a template. The original Spribe Plinko is a crypto-native instant win title. Then you have slot versions from BGaming, Hacksaw and others that add free spins or bonus rounds. And a few live casino studios have tried to turn the pegboard into a hosted game show. For UK players, the crypto versions dominate because they’re fast and provably fair, but the slot variants are easier to find at licensed casinos.

Original Spribe Plinko

Spribe’s Plinko is the reference point. It runs on a provably fair algorithm, lets you adjust rows and risk, and has no extra features. Pure, unadulterated peg-drop. The house edge is around 3% for low-risk settings and slightly higher for high-risk, though exact RTP varies by casino integration. That’s the game most offshore casinos carry.

BGaming Plinko Slot

BGaming turned Plinko into a video slot with a bonus buy option and free spins. The slot version adds a bit of structure—collect scatter symbols to trigger a Plinko bonus round—but the core mechanic is the same. You’ll find this version at hybrid casinos like 7BitCasino and BitStarz, where it sits alongside traditional slots and table games.

Plinko Casino Real Money Withdrawals and Payouts

When you win at Plinko, the withdrawal speed depends almost entirely on the casino, not the game. Crypto casinos process payouts in minutes because they skip the banking layer; fiat-accepting hybrids take 1–3 banking days after approval. UK players using a bank card or e-wallet at an offshore site will face additional friction: some banks block gambling transactions, and the casino may ask for more KYC documents than you’d expect.

The most common withdrawal pain point is the minimum payout threshold. At some crypto Plinko casinos, you can cash out as little as £20, but others set the floor at £50 or even £100. If you’re playing low stakes and hit a lucky multiplier, you might not meet the threshold, so you’ll have to keep playing or forfeit the win. Read the withdrawal policy before you deposit. And never use a credit card at an offshore casino—the fees are obscene and some UK banks treat it as a cash advance.

Is Plinko Casino Legit? Licensing and Safety for UK Players

Legitimacy is a spectrum. A Plinko casino is not automatically a scam just because it lacks a UKGC licence, but you lose the UK’s formal complaint process and self-exclusion tools. The reputable offshore operators are licensed in Curacao, Anjouan or Gibraltar and have been around for years; the dodgy ones run on copied software and vanish after a few months. For UK players, the practical test is simple: check the casino’s licence number, search for player complaints about withdrawals, and never deposit more than you can afford to lose.

The UKGC itself does not ban Plinko, but it has made life hard for crypto casinos by tightening advertising and payment rules. That’s why most UKGC-licensed casinos avoid the game altogether—they don’t want the compliance headache for a title that appeals mainly to crypto gamblers. So if you see a UKGC casino advertising a Plinko game, it’s almost certainly a slot version from a licensed provider, not the original Spribe title. The experience is different, and the RTP is usually lower.

Responsible Gambling

Plinko’s fast pace and high variance make it particularly easy to lose track of time and money. The game is designed to keep you clicking, and the occasional big multiplier reinforces the behaviour. The most effective harm reduction tool is a pre-commitment: set a deposit limit before you open the game, and use the casino’s built-in cool-off or self-exclusion features if you need them. Offshore casinos often have weaker responsible gambling tools than UKGC sites, so you may have to rely on your own discipline.

If you’re in the UK and gambling is causing problems, GamCare and BeGambleAware offer free support. The National Gambling Helpline is 0808 8020 133. Don’t chase losses on Plinko—the random walk doesn’t care about your last 50 drops.
